Responsibilities

Designs, develops, and implements strategies to improve supplier quality performance in a sustainable way
Identify and mitigate any quality related risks
Ensure quality and cost effectiveness of materials by deploying processes, capability tools and continuous improvement projects
Monitor supplier key performance indicators
Investigate and manage supplier non-conforming issues and related roots causes analysis to implement sustainable corrective actions (8D/5WHY'S)
Launch actions as needed to meet Safran targets
Review and manage First Article Inspection Reports
Coordinate the quality related actions between the suppliers and the Safran Cabin cross functional team stakeholders: procurement, engineering, commodity management and SPM
Support Source Inspection at Supplier sites as needed
Support new product introduction, including Process Failure Mode Effects Analysis (PFMEA)
Ensure continued compliance of supplier with inspection delegation requirements (periodic on-site audit, monitoring of effectiveness of supplier delegation process)
Perform evaluation of new and current suppliers in order to ensure compliance with Safran quality and regulatory requirements (e.g., AS9100)
Follow up on corrective actions (CAR) resulting from audit findings
Based on the supplier risk level, perform periodic assessments of current suppliers in order to identify and mitigate the risks
Perform trainings internally and externally as needed
Initiate supplier development projects
